How to use IFSC Code IDIB000S583?

The main use of IFSC code IDIB000S583 is to facilitate electronic funds transfer from one account to other account. This code solely represents the SARILA branch of Indian Bank which participates in three main payment and settlement systems such as National Electronic Fund Transfer (NEFT), Real Time Gross Settlement (RTGS) and Immediate Payment Services (IMPS).

You can initiate fund transfer to any bank account at Indian Bank, SARILA Branch through NEFT, RTGS and IMPS. Though you have account number and payee name, you need to have IFSC Code of Indian Bank, SARILA Branch for fund transfer.
